Psilocybin (IPA: /sa?l??sa?b?n/) (also known as psilocybine ) is a psychedelic indole of the tryptamine family, found in psilocybin mushrooms . It is present in hundreds of species of fungi , including those of the genus Psilocybe , such as Psilocybe cubensis and Psilocybe semilanceata , but also reportedly isolated from a dozen or so other genera. Psilocybin mushrooms are commonly called "magic mushrooms" or more simply "shrooms". Possession, and in some cases usage, of psilocybin or psilocin has been outlawed in most countries across the globe. [ 1 ] Proponents of its usage consider it to be an entheogen and a tool to supplement various types of practices for transcendence , including in meditation , psychonautics , and psychedelic psychotherapy . The intensity and duration of entheogenic effects of psilocybin mushrooms are highly variable, depending on species/cultivar of mushrooms, dosage, individual physiology, and set and setting . Though psilocybin rarely attracts much attention from mainstream media, when it does the focus tends to be on the recreational use, generally excluding any other uses of the drug.
